Understanding the Anxious Generation
The term "anxious generation" has come to symbolize the struggles faced by today's youth, particularly those in their tweens and teens. Rising levels of anxiety, depression, and other mental health challenges have been linked to several factors, including the pervasive influence of digital technology, social media pressures, and a growing culture of safetyism.
The Impact of Technology
Research has consistently shown that excessive screen time can lead to detrimental effects on mental health. A study published in the American Journal of Preventive Medicine found that adolescents who spend more than three hours a day on recreational screen time are at a higher risk for mental health problems, including anxiety and depression. The constant comparison facilitated by social media can exacerbate feelings of inadequacy and isolation among young people.
Haidt emphasizes that while technology is not inherently harmful, the way it is used can lead to significant consequences. He argues that the lack of opportunities for young people to engage in risk-taking behavior—whether through unsupervised play, exploration, or social interactions—has contributed to the rise in anxiety. By shielding children from risks, parents and educators may unintentionally foster a generation that is less resilient and less equipped to handle the challenges of adulthood.
The Role of Parenting and Safetyism
The parenting style prevalent in recent years, characterized by heightened protection and an emphasis on safety, has had a profound effect on children's development. This "safetyism" culture has emerged as a response to real threats, such as school shootings and the pervasive dangers of the internet. However, Haidt argues that this overprotectiveness has led to the stifling of independence and self-efficacy among young people.
Children who are not allowed to experience manageable risks may struggle to develop critical life skills, such as decision-making, problem-solving, and resilience. This lack of experience can leave them ill-prepared for the uncertainties of adulthood, leading to heightened anxiety and insecurity.
The Amazing Generation: A New Narrative
In The Amazing Generation, Jonathan Haidt aims to reframe the discussion around youth mental health by positioning tweens as capable individuals who can thrive in a digital world. The book serves as a practical guide for pre-teens aged 9-12, encouraging them to engage with their environment actively and to harness their potential beyond the confines of screens.
Emphasizing Fun and Freedom
Haidt's approach is rooted in the belief that fun and freedom are essential components of a fulfilling life. He advocates for a balanced lifestyle that incorporates outdoor play, creative pursuits, and social interactions—elements that have become increasingly scarce for children today. The book encourages readers to seek joy in the real world, fostering connections with peers and nature.
By providing strategies and insights, Haidt aims to empower tweens to take control of their lives, encouraging them to make choices that enhance their well-being. He believes that by cultivating a sense of agency, children can combat the anxiety that stems from feeling overwhelmed or trapped by their circumstances.
Practical Strategies for Tweens
The Amazing Generation will include actionable advice and exercises designed to help young readers navigate the challenges posed by technology. Haidt collaborates with Catherine Price, author of How to Break Up with Your Phone, to create a comprehensive resource that addresses the complexities of digital life.
Among the practical strategies discussed, the book will cover:
- Mindful Technology Use: Teaching tweens how to set boundaries around their screen time and engage with technology in a way that enhances rather than detracts from their lives.
- Fostering Independence: Encouraging young readers to explore their interests, take risks, and engage in activities that promote personal growth and self-discovery.
- Building Resilience: Providing tools and techniques to help tweens cope with challenges and setbacks, fostering a growth mindset that enables them to view obstacles as opportunities for learning.
